三、任务型阅读
阅读下面短文,根据短文内容,从短文后的方框中选出能填入空白处的最佳选项。
Teenage Life—Better Now, Or in the Past?
Does this situation sound familiar (熟悉的)?
You are complaining (抱怨) to your parents about something. Maybe your computer isn’t powerful enough to play the latest games. (1)
C
Then you hear...
“When I was your age, there weren’t any computers or video games. And I didn’t get a bike until I was sixteen. And it was secondhand. (2)
A

So, is it really true that life is better for teenagers now? It is certainly true that many teenagers have got more things nowadays. (3)
B
So parents have got more money to spend on each child. And many things are cheaper than they were when our parents were children.
(4)
E
Forty years ago, no one could imagine a world with tiny computers and amazing smartphones. And now these things are necessary we can’t imagine living without them!
However, technology often means we spend more time at home. And often it’s just us, with our computer or television. Teenagers don’t do enough exercise. (5)
D
And, although young people still get on well with their friends, some people think teenagers today don’t have so many social activities as they did in the past.
What do you think? Is teenage life better these days?
A. And it was too big for me.
B. A typical family is smaller now.
C. Or your friends’ bikes are better than yours!
D. So they aren’t as healthy as teenagers in the past.
E. Technology is probably the greatest change in our life.
答案: 1. C 【解析】本段意:你会向你的父母抱怨一些事情。或许你会抱怨你的电脑不能玩最新的游戏……C项(或者你朋友们的自行车比你的好)也属于抱怨的内容之一。
2. A 【解析】由上文“And I didn't get a bike until I was sixteen. And it was second-hand.”可知,上文是父母对孩子说的话,他们年轻时拥有的自行车是二手的,选项A也是父母对那个年代自行车的描述,因此A项符合语境。
3. B 【解析】由空格后的“So parents have got more money to spend on each child.”可知,父母在每个孩子身上花的钱更多了。由此可推断,现在每个家庭的孩子少了,也就是家庭的规模越来越小了,故选B项。
4. E 【解析】本段是对过去和现在在科技方面的对比,因此E项(科技可能是我们生活中最大的改变)符合文意。
5. D 【解析】由空格前的“Teenagers don't do enough exercise.”以及空格后的内容可知,本段主要讲了现在的青少年远不如过去的青少年健康,故D项符合文意。
